Five tough questions to ask about reaching net zero climate targets by Kim_PhD in environment

[–]Kim_PhD[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Anyone setting a net zero target – and the citizens, activists, consumers, and investors holding them to account – needs to ask the following questions.

  1. What are you covering?
  2. When is your deadline?
  3. How will you get there?
  4. What are you doing today?
  5. How will you stay on track over 30 years of disruptive change?

Throwing away the throwaway society by Kim_PhD in environment

[–]Kim_PhD[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

The main goal of the Circular Economy Action Plan is mainstreaming circularity and decoupling it from resources extraction. It’s part of a broader environmental shift by the European Commission that includes the Green Deal and Industrial Strategy and aims to make the bloc climate neutral by 2050.

Recycling in the U.S. Is Broken. How Do We Fix It? by Kim_PhD in environment

[–]Kim_PhD[S] 2 points3 points  (0 children)

The author said the key to fixing recycling in the U.S. is developing the domestic market. If recycling processors have a market where they can sell their material, they will be motivated to invest in better equipment that can sort materials to minimize contamination, and it will make economic sense to expand recycling programs.
